How they compare
Chile currently reports 23.01 1000 USD against 19.62 1000 USD in Malaysia, a difference of 3.39 1000 USD.
That makes Chile's figure about 1.2 times Malaysia's.
The two have swapped places 3 times across 9 shared years of data; in 2013 it was Malaysia ahead.
Chile ranks 22nd and Malaysia ranks 23rd of 58 countries.
Across the 2 decades both report, Chile averaged higher in 1 and Malaysia in 1.

About this data
The FAOSTAT Pesticides Trade domain contains data on internationally traded pesticides (values and quantities). Data are sourced from international and national trade statistics, predominantly from UN COMTRADE (from 1990 onwards) or from national country trade tapes (1961-1990). Data for the period 1961-1989 cover only Import and Export values (FAOSTAT element codes 5622 and 5922). Data from 1990 onwards also include Import and Export quantities (codes 5610 and 5910) and include a complete time-series for Pesticides (total). The domain contains information on the trade of pesticides products in either: a) finished forms and/or packaging; or b) separate chemically-defined compounds relevant to the Rotterdam Convention on the Prior Informed Consent Procedure for Certain Hazardous Chemicals and Pesticides in International Trade.
